Here’s Another Hilarious Trailer for John Travolta’s ‘Life on The Line’

John Travolta is probably the most unintentionally funny actor going today. From his weird hair situations to ridiculous accents, to Nicolas Cage-esque levels of over-acting in bargain basement VOD movies, Johnny T gives us gold time and time again. And Life on The Line appears to be no different.

This is a “drama” about line workers in a storm, and it features the one-two punch of funny facial hair and silly accent from Travolta. Enjoy this second trailer:

Haunted by the electrocution death of his brother, Beau is devoted to niece Bailey and determined to see her go off to college and away from the life of linemen. Bailey has other plans, which include the strapping second-generation lineman Duncan, whom Beau despises. A deadly tempest is brewing and headed straight to their Texas town. Beau, Duncan and a legion of linemen are thrust into the eye of the storm and must face down impending disaster to keep their community connected.

Life on The Line appears to have everything a stock “dangerous career” movie needs to have: seasoned veteran, young kid in love who deserves a better career, danger, accents, goatees… and Sharon Stone? Hmm, okay.

Life on The Line opens November 18, I’m assuming at a TV near you. Like the one in your living room.
